Zum Hauptinhalt springen
Nicht aus der Schweiz? Besuchen Sie lehmanns.de
Das Konzept implizit typisierter Variablen und Dynamic Objects mit Bezug auf deren Umsetzung in C# 4.0 - Alexander Rothe

Das Konzept implizit typisierter Variablen und Dynamic Objects mit Bezug auf deren Umsetzung in C# 4.0

(Autor)

Buch | Softcover
24 Seiten
2010 | 10003 A. 3. Auflage
GRIN Verlag
978-3-640-78251-2 (ISBN)
CHF 23,70 inkl. MwSt
  • Titel nicht im Sortiment
  • Artikel merken
Studienarbeit aus dem Jahr 2010 im Fachbereich Informatik - Wirtschaftsinformatik, Note: 1,3, Helmut-Schmidt-Universität - Universität der Bundeswehr Hamburg, Veranstaltung: Softwareentwicklung, Sprache: Deutsch, Abstract: C# gehört zu den in letzten Jahren meistverwendeten Programmiersprachen. Die Sprache bleibt nicht auf einem Punkt stehen. Mittlerweile ist die Version 4.0 eingeführt worden und der Sprachumfang wächst mit jeder neuen Version. Die ansteigende Funktionalität und der in den Vordergrund rückende Komfort steigern die Mächtigkeit von C# mit jeder Version. Der Grundgedanke den C# von Anfang an verfolgt, eine stark typisierten Sprache mit der Gewährleistung einer hohen Typsicherheit, soll bestehen bleiben. C# wurde konzipiert, um robuste und langlebige Komponenten entwickeln zu können, die die Bewältigung des realen Lebens erleichtern. Die Komponenten bilden den Mittelpunkt für alle Objekte und stellen die Kernelemente der Sprache. Robustheit und Langlebigkeit der Software sind wichtige Aspekte, die monatelang laufende Webserver ohne außerplanmäßige Neustarts ermöglicht haben. Gerade die einfache, sichere und intuitive Umgebung sowie eine Fehlerbehandlung die Ausnahmebehandlungen ermöglicht, haben dazu beigetragen. Die wichtigste Voraussetzung dafür liegt in der Typsicherheit der Sprache. Sie schützt den Programmierer vor unsicheren Typumwandlungen, vor nicht initialisierten Variablen und anderen häufig auftretenden Programmierfehlern.3In dem Entwicklungsprozess von C# und mit dem Erscheinen neuer Versionen hat sich an der Typisierung in C# grundlegendes verändert. Ab Version 3.0 ist die Verwendung implizit typisierter Variablen erlaubt. In Version 4.0 wurde mit den dynamischen Objekten noch einen Schritt weiter gegangen. Die vorliegende Seminararbeit soll einen Einblick in diese zwei Konzepte geben und sich mit deren Herkunft und Funktionsweise auseinander setzen. Die Frage bei der Beurteilung der Innovationen ist, ob und warum Veränderungen in dem Typsystem durchgeführt wurden. Die Begründung der Vorteile ist genauso maßgeblich, wie das Aufdecken von Nachteilen. Der zusammenfassende Vergleich ermöglicht einen Überblick, wann implizit typisierte Variablen oder dynamische Objekte eingesetzt werden können. Dabei ist der Grundgedanken von C#, die Entwicklung langlebiger und robuster Programme, zu bewahren.
Sprache deutsch
Maße 148 x 210 mm
Gewicht 49 g
Themenwelt Mathematik / Informatik Informatik Programmiersprachen / -werkzeuge
Schlagworte Bezug • C sharp 4.0 (Programmiersprache) • dynamic • Informatik • Konzept • objects • Umsetzung • Variablen
ISBN-10 3-640-78251-8 / 3640782518
ISBN-13 978-3-640-78251-2 / 9783640782512
Zustand Neuware
Informationen gemäß Produktsicherheitsverordnung (GPSR)
Haben Sie eine Frage zum Produkt?
Mehr entdecken
aus dem Bereich
Grundlagen und praktische Anwendungen von Transpondern, kontaktlosen …

von Klaus Finkenzeller

Buch (2023)
Hanser (Verlag)
CHF 125,95
Programmiersprache, grafische Benutzeroberflächen, Anwendungen

von Ulrich Stein

Buch | Hardcover (2023)
Hanser (Verlag)
CHF 55,95